In general, the highest relative humidity is observed NEAR SUNRISE and the lowest relative humidity is observed during MID-AFTERNOON.
Relative humidity is inversely proportional to temperature. The colder the climate, the higher the relative humidity. The hotter the temperatures outside, the lower the relative humidity.
Relative humidity increases as the air temperature falls at night and peaks at dawn.
Temperature peaks during mid-afternoon, thus relative humidity is at its lowest.
